N2 - Central venous catheters are routinely used for resuscitation, chemotherapy and nutrition but are not without risk. Central lines are the most common extrinsic cause of venous thrombosis in neonates and infants. We present an ex-36 week 1800g infant baby girl recovering after a staged repair of gastroschisis with ileostomy and mucous fistula formation. The patient was receiving parenteral nutrition through an indwelling saphenous vein tunneled catheter, with its tip in the inferior vena cava. The patient developed polyuria, with a characteristic odor of the parenteral nutrition and a urine analysis showed glucose and triglyceride levels consistent with the composition of the parenteral nutrition fluid. A fluoroscopic cysto-urogram and an inferior vena-cavogram showed a catheter-associated inferior vena cava thrombosis leading to backpressure changes, diverting all intravenous contrast into the right renal vein and to renal collecting system, thus elucidating the route of the parenteral nutrition fluid reaching the bladder. Our case represents an extreme case of complicated central venous thrombosis. We emphasize the importance of practicing a high index of suspicion for thrombotic complications in severely ill neonates with central venous access. An early diagnosis and aggressive management may prevent progression of the disease towards an overwhelming complication.
